Output e2c999950a4efd2522d388a0a8306b0a657c7e27ae41af69d6b6493210d06ed3:1

value
1016756
script pubkey
OP_0 OP_PUSHBYTES_20 50465ec621ee645464324912c10cc197dce2754f
address
bc1q2pr9a33paej9gepjfyfvzrxpjlwwya20spfsqw
transaction
e2c999950a4efd2522d388a0a8306b0a657c7e27ae41af69d6b6493210d06ed3
spent
true